Utilidad de un sistema de seguimiento óptico de instrumental en cirugía laparoscópica para evaluación de destrezas motoras

Resumen Introduccion En este trabajo se estudia la utilidad de un sistema de evaluacion de destrezas quirurgicas basado en el analisis de los movimientos del instrumental laparoscopico. Metodo El sistema consta de un simulador fisico laparoscopico y un sistema de seguimiento y evaluacion de habilidades tecnicas quirurgicas. En el estudio han participado 6 cirujanos con experiencia intermedia (entre 1 y 50 intervenciones laparoscopicas) y 5 cirujanos expertos (mas de 50 intervenciones laparoscopicas), todos ellos con la mano derecha como dominante. Cada sujeto realizo 3 repeticiones de una tarea de corte con la mano derecha en tejido sintetico, una diseccion de la serosa gastrica y una sutura en la diseccion realizada. Para cada ejercicio se analizaron los parametros de tiempo, distancia recorrida, velocidad, aceleracion y suavidad de movimientos para los instrumentos de ambas manos. Resultados En la tarea de corte, los cirujanos expertos muestran menor aceleracion (p = 0,014) y mayor suavidad en los movimientos (p = 0,023) en el uso de la tijera. Respecto a la actividad de diseccion, los cirujanos expertos requieren menos tiempo (p = 0,006) y recorren menos distancia con ambos instrumentos (p = 0,006 para disector y p = 0,01 para tijera). En la tarea de sutura, los cirujanos expertos presentan menor tiempo de ejecucion que los cirujanos de nivel intermedio (p = 0,037) y recorren menos distancia con el disector (p = 0,041). Conclusiones El sistema de evaluacion se mostro util en las tareas de corte, diseccion y sutura, y constituye un progreso en el desarrollo de sistemas avanzados de entrenamiento y evaluacion de destrezas quirurgicas laparoscopicas.
